- Description
- A 5-year-old Islay single malt from Bruichladdich peated to 101.4ppm and matured entirely in first-fill bourbon casks, bottled at 59.3% ABV. This entry point to the Octomore 16 series demonstrates how even heavily peated Islay whisky can balance intensity with refinement.
